Residential pest control services involve the identification, treatment, and prevention of pests within a home environment. These services typically include inspections to locate pest activity and entry points, followed by targeted treatments that may involve the application of sprays, baits, or traps. The goal is to eliminate existing infestations and establish barriers that prevent future pest problems. Many providers also offer advice on reducing attractants and sealing entry points to enhance the effectiveness of ongoing pest management efforts.
These services help address a variety of common household pest issues, such as ants, cockroaches, spiders, rodents, and bed bugs. Pests can cause property damage, contaminate food, and pose health risks to residents. Effective pest control can reduce the likelihood of infestations spreading or recurring, helping to maintain a safe and comfortable living environment. Regular treatments may be recommended for ongoing protection, especially in areas prone to pest activity or where previous problems have occurred.

The overview below groups typical Residential Pest Control proj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Plano,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Initial Treatment - The cost for a one-time residential pest control treatment typically ranges from $150 to $300, depending on the size of the property and pest type. This service aims to eliminate existing pests and establish a barrier to prevent future infestations.
Recurring Services - Ongoing pest control services usually cost between $40 and $70 per visit, with most homeowners scheduling treatments every one to three months. Regular visits help maintain pest-free conditions and address new pest activity promptly.
Specialized Treatments - Treatments for specific pests like termites or bed bugs can vary from $500 to over $2,000, depending on the infestation severity and property size. These services often require multiple visits or inspections to ensure complete eradication.
Inspection Fees - Many service providers charge an inspection fee ranging from $50 to $150, which may be credited toward treatment costs if services are scheduled. Inspections help identify pest issues and determine appropriate treatment plans.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of pests can residential pest control services address? Residential pest control providers typically handle common household pests such as ants, cockroaches, spiders, termites, rodents, and bed bugs.
How often should pest control treatments be scheduled? The frequency of treatments depends on the pest problem and property conditions; a local pest control professional can recommend a suitable schedule.
Are residential pest control services safe for children and pets? Most pest control providers use methods and products designed to be safe for households with children and pets, but it is advisable to discuss concerns with the service provider.
What should homeowners do before a pest control treatment? Homeowners are usually advised to clear the area of personal belongings and food items, and follow any specific instructions provided by the service provider.
How long does a typical pest control treatment take? The duration of a treatment varies based on the size of the property and the pest issue, but many treatments can be completed within a few hours.
